1. 開発者Learn
  2. 隐藏串扰的技巧

隐藏串扰的技巧

这是使用空间现实显示屏 (Spatial Reality Display) 的创作者提供的内容创建技巧的第三部分。

这次,我们将介绍在Hololab公司工作、从ELF-SR1时代就开始创作内容的Ogacyo的文章内容。

什么是串扰

在空间现实显示屏中,具有左右视差的图像分别显示在左眼和右眼上,从而创建具有自然立体感的图像。但是,如果前后放置颜色或对比度差异较大的对象,则可能会出现重影等症状。

这种现象被称为串扰。

SDK站点链接:关于串扰

如果发生这种串扰,立体效果将受损。我们将介绍通过制作内容来改善串扰的技术。

ogacyo_x1看起来有重影的部分

 

Note

在Spatial Reality Display Settings Ver.2.1.0和主机固件1.20.00及更高版本中,我们可以单独优化串扰,使其不明显。

详细内容请参照“串扰调整”。

■处理方法

有以下两种处理方法。

  1. 减少相邻对象之间的色差。
  2. 尽可能不将要显示的内容放在边缘。

■1.减少相邻对象之间的色差

这是一种减少串扰突出的对象之间的色差的方法,如下图所示,使其不明显。

30
ogacyo_x1

白色

ogacyo_x2

深灰色

ogacyo_x3

黑色

 

将立方体的颜色从白色→深灰色→黑色改变的示例。串扰在黑色中变得更加明显的原因是因为使用的背景不是全黑。

此外,虽然在这张照片中看不到,但立方体左侧的串扰已经减少,但现在与地板的边界处的串扰更加明显。

如果您不想更改对象的颜色,改善照明并且不照亮边缘也是有效的。

ogacyo_x4
ogacyo_x5

Note

如果背景是黑色并且与主对象的对比度差异太大,则串扰可能会变得明显,因此应尽可能避免它

■2.尽可能不将要显示的内容放在边缘

这是一种不将用户的视线移动到易于发生串扰的地方的方法。

ogacyo_x6

将要显示的对象放置在中心的示例。因为没有任何东西,即使中心的对象移动,除非移动到边缘,否则用户的注意力会集中在在显示的对象上,很难注意到边缘的串扰。

此外,由于人类倾向于关注移动的物体,因此不在边缘放置移动物体也是有效的。

ogacyo_x7

除了要在中心显示的对象之外,不放置任何内容的示例。虽然如果没有显示对象就不会发生串扰,但与有DisplayBox时相比,很难感受到立体效果。

此时,根据背景颜色和安装环境,侧面板看起来反射在显示屏上,并且它可能通过变成伪DisplayBox来帮助立体效果。

ogacyo_x8
我认为只要意识到这种技术,内容的质量就会提高很多。请试一试。

株式会社Hololab接受使用空间现实显示屏/Spatial Reality Display等各种设备的开发咨询。
有兴趣的朋友请通过以下联系方式与我们联系。

hololab_logo

株式会社Hololab
https://hololab.co.jp/#contact

创作者:Ogacyo
https://twitter.com/ogacyo

 

Support information

应用的创建方法

如何在空间现实显示屏上显示从Sketchfab下载的3D内容,并详细介绍了具体步骤和设置方法。

Details
【应用介绍】 Sketchfab 3D 查看器

了解如何使用 Sketchfab 3D 查看器在空间现实显示屏上轻松查看和共享 3D 模型,提升您的开发体验。

Details
让我们在第二个屏幕上创建一个 GUI

在Unity中使用SRDisplay插件创建自定义纹理的第二屏显示和GUI按钮切换功能的详细指南。

Details